Silver State Health Insurance Exchange Won't Open Physical Stores

The state will not open physical stores to enroll people in health insurance programs this year.

The Las Vegas Sun reports Nevada's Silver State Health Insurance Exchange decided not to open stores this year because not many people used them.

Last year, less than ten percent of total enrollees to the exchange signed up at either the store in Las Vegas or at the one in Northern Nevada.

Along with the low usage rate, the insurance exchange's budget was cut this year, making the physical stores less cost-effective.
